Huawei donates maize meal to Kenyan IDP
NAIROBI, March 14, 2008 -- Huawei Technologies Co., LTD. Friday donated six tons of maize meal to the Kenya Red Cross to help the people who were internally displaced in Kenya's post-election turmoil.



At the donating ceremony, He Zhaomin, CEO of Huawei Technologies Kenya, said: "Kenya is in the midst of a healing process and it is our privilege to continue to support the internally displaced persons as they endeavor to rebuild their lives."

Zulekha Abass, business development manager of the Kenya Red Cross, thanked Huawei on behalf of the displaced people, saying the victims have a long way to go to recover the normal life.

More than 1,000 people were killed and about 350,000 others displaced in the national crisis triggered by the disputed presidential election held in the East African Country in December 2007.

The Kenyan government and the opposition signed late last month a power-sharing deal, which is highly expected to put a full stop to the turmoil and initiate the national reconciliation process.
